Subscriber Data Management (SDM) is a critical component of India telecom landscape, as it plays a pivotal role in managing user information, authentication, and authorization. The market for SDM solutions in India has witnessed substantial growth, with telecom operators looking to streamline their operations and enhance the user experience. As the India telecom industry evolves, SDM is expected to remain a cornerstone of network efficiency and customer engagement.
The India Subscriber Data Management market is primarily driven by the increasing subscriber base in the telecom industry. Telecom operators are striving to efficiently manage and utilize subscriber data to provide personalized services, enhance customer experiences, and support targeted marketing. The growth of 4G and 5G networks also plays a significant role in this market, as they generate a vast amount of data that requires effective management.
Challenges in the India subscriber data management market include handling vast amounts of data and ensuring data accuracy. Telecom operators must manage extensive subscriber databases while addressing issues related to data quality, privacy, and compliance with data protection regulations.
The subscriber data management market became critical during the pandemic as telecom operators needed to manage and monetize subscriber data effectively. This market saw growth as operators aimed to enhance their customer offerings.
In the India Subscriber Data Management market, key players offer solutions for managing subscriber information and authentication in the telecommunications sector. Notable companies in this space include Ericsson AB, Huawei Technologies Co., Ltd., Nokia Corporation, and Amdocs, Inc. These companies provide subscriber data management systems that are crucial for telecom operators to efficiently manage user profiles, authenticate subscribers, and deliver personalized services.

Export potential enables firms to identify high-growth global markets with greater confidence by combining advanced trade intelligence with a structured quantitative methodology. The framework analyzes emerging demand trends and country-level import patterns while integrating macroeconomic and trade datasets such as GDP and population forecasts, bilateral import–export flows, tariff structures, elasticity differentials between developed and developing economies, geographic distance, and import demand projections. Using weighted trade values from 2020–2024 as the base period to project country-to-country export potential for 2030, these inputs are operationalized through calculated drivers such as gravity model parameters, tariff impact factors, and projected GDP per-capita growth. Through an analysis of hidden potentials, demand hotspots, and market conditions that are most favorable to success, this method enables firms to focus on target countries, maximize returns, and global expansion with data, backed by accuracy.
By factoring in the projected importer demand gap that is currently unmet and could be potential opportunity, it identifies the potential for the Exporter (Country) among 190 countries, against the general trade analysis, which identifies the biggest importer or exporter.
